Hello all and happy new year ! I am new at OpenCA, and I have a little problem. I use Redhat 7.1, OpenCA 0.8.1,OpenSSL 0.9.7-pre1. I set up a test CA/RA on the same machine, that seems to work (the CA was initialized correctly, the Web sites of the RA can be accessed and seems OK). But when I try to create a server certificate, on the RA, I give the filename of the request, the PIN, etc..., the next screen is Ok, but when I press continue, I get the Apache error "Method not allowed: The requested method POST is not allowed for the URL /index.html". I am surprised because this kind of message usualy comes from misconfiguration of apache but other cgi scripts seems to work (CA certificate correctly issued for example). I try to look at pkcs10_req but I did find where the problem is. I have the same kind of problem for IE certificate and Netscape... Any idea of what I missed ? Thank you. Regards. Stephane MASSON.
